Ferry - Inchelium Hiway Rehabilitation

Project Number: 1019-02
From milepost 2.16 to milepost 4.48
RATA Funds: $749,700
Legislative District: 7
Status:
Date Approved: 2019
The Inchelium Highway is the most traveled County Roadway, which connects travelers to the Colville Indian Reservation, the Kettle River, and into Inchelium. The highway is important to for the transportation of freight and goods and the logging industry.

The section of the Highway had linear and transverse cracking, shoulder deterioration, and rutting.

To protect the worst areas from further deterioration, a Pre-Level was used prior to the new Chip Seal. New road signs were installed.
